EU Official Journal Notices for May 23

In the May 23 edition of the Official Journal of the European Union the following trade-related notices were posted:

  • Infant formula. Commission Delegated Regulation (EU) 2019/828 of 14 March 2019 amending Delegated Regulation (EU) 2016/127 with regard to vitamin D requirements for infant formula and erucic acid requirements for infant formula and follow-on formula (here).
  • Plant pest protection. Commission Delegated Regulation (EU) 2019/829 of 14 March 2019 supplementing Regulation (EU) 2016/2031 of the European Parliament and of the Council on protective measures against pests of plants, authorising Member States to provide for temporary derogations in view of official testing, scientific or educational purposes, trials, varietal selections, or breeding (here).
  • Classification -- mobile phone case. Commission Implementing Regulation (EU) 2019/830 of 15 May 2019 concerning the classification of certain goods in the Combined Nomenclature (here).
  • Cosmetics. Commission Regulation (EU) 2019/831 of 22 May 2019 amending Annexes II, III and V to Regulation (EC) No 1223/2009 of the European Parliament and of the Council on cosmetic products (here).
